The ASTM A109/A109M standard covers cold-rolled carbon steel strip in cut lengths or coils. Unlike cold-rolled sheet, the strip designation implies a product with tighter tolerances and specific metallurgical properties. The material is produced to meet specific "tempers," which represent a range of mechanical properties from full hard to dead soft. Key Characteristics of ASTM A109 Steel
